CS/CS/HB 1443 (2012) -  Local Administrative Action to Abate Public Nuisances and Criminal Gang Activity

by Community & Military Affairs Subcommittee and Criminal Justice Subcommittee and Frishe (CO-SPONSORS) Ahern
Authorizes local administrative board to declare place to be public nuisance if used on more than two occasions within 6-month period as site of storage of controlled substance with specified intent; authorizes administrative board to hear complaints regarding pain-management clinic declared public nuisance; prohibits county or municipality from declaring place or premises public nuisance unless county or municipality gives notice to owner of place or premises of intent to declare place or premises public nuisance & affords owner opportunity to abate nuisance; provides that order entered against person for public nuisance expires after 1 year or earlier if so stated unless order violated; requires that board conduct hearing to determine whether person violated administrative order; authorizes administrative board to seek injunctive relief against pain-management clinic declared public nuisance; authorizes board to extend term of order by up to 1 additional year & to impose penalty if board finds order violated; authorizes county or municipal ordinance to include fines for public nuisance activities outside specified period; authorizes local ordinance to provide for continuing jurisdiction over place or premises that are subject to extension of administrative order.
Effective Date: July 1, 2012
Last Event: 03/09/12 S Died in Criminal Justice on Friday, March 9, 2012 11:59 PM
